Feminist Theory: From Margin to Center is a book written by bell hooks that explores the intersecting issues of race, class, and gender within feminist movements. The book critiques mainstream feminism for ignoring the experiences and perspectives of marginalized women.

Key Features

  • Critique of mainstream feminism
  • Intersectional analysis of race, class, and gender
  • Focus on centering marginalized voices
  • Calls for a more inclusive and diverse feminist movement
